搭建服务器后网站为何无法在外网打开?你可能忽视了这些细节!

在如今互联网高度发达的时代,越来越多的人选择自己搭建网站。无论是为了个人博客还是企业宣传,搭建一个属于自己的网站都是一件充满挑战和乐趣的事情。有时候你会发现,虽然服务器搭建完成,却无法在外网打开你的站点,这究竟是为什么呢?

网络配置问题

网络配置是一个重要的因素。如果你是在局域网中搭建服务器,那么外网用户是无法直接通过局域网的IP地址访问你的服务器的。此时,你需要检查路由器的设置,确保端口转发已经正确配置,将流量导向你的服务器。确认防火墙是否阻止了外部访问也是至关重要的。

域名解析

图片[1]-搭建服务器后网站为何无法在外网打开?你可能忽视了这些细节!-SEO论坛-分享经验-东莞市快语信息咨询有限公司

对于使用域名的站点来说,域名解析的问题可能会导致外网无法访问。确保你的域名已经正确解析到服务器的公网IP地址,通常解析记录需要一定时间才能生效。如果是刚购买的域名,耐心等待,并使用命令行工具(如ping或nslookup)来检查域名是否已正确解析。

服务器软件配置

搭建好服务器后,是否对各项服务进行了正确的配置,例如Web服务器?在使用Apache或Nginx等服务器软件时,配置文件中的域名和端口设置都非常关键。如果配置不当,即使请求到达服务器,也可能因为端口未监听或者虚拟主机配置错误导致无法正常访问。

网站内容问题

图片[2]-搭建服务器后网站为何无法在外网打开?你可能忽视了这些细节!-SEO论坛-分享经验-东莞市快语信息咨询有限公司

另一种可能性是网站内容本身的问题。如果服务器返回的HTTP状态码不是200 OK,外部用户在访问时会受到限制。常见的状态码有404(未找到)或500(服务器内部错误),这个时候就需要仔细检查代码是否存在bug或者路径是否正确。

SSL证书配置

如果你的网站启用了HTTPS,而SSL证书没有正确安装或配置,也会导致外网无法访问。确保SSL证书是有效的,并且在Web服务器的配置文件中正确设置了相关条目。使用在线工具可以检测SSL设置是否正常。

ISP限制

不容忽视的是,有些互联网服务提供商(ISP)可能会对某些端口进行限制。特别是使用标准HTTP的80端口和HTTPS的443端口时,如果您无法访问,联系ISP确认是否存在相关限制。

搭建服务器,开设网站,是一项值得探讨与尝试的事情,但也会遇到不少挑战。了解这些潜在问题,才能更好地解决外网无法访问的问题, ensuring你的作品能够被更多人看到。

© 版权声明
THE END
喜欢就支持一下吧
点赞12 分享
评论 抢沙发

请登录后发表评论

    暂无评论内容